Arapahoe rolls past Wilcox-Hildreth

WILCOX - With scoring outbursts in the second and third quarters, the Arapahoe boys basketball team rolled to a 61-31 victory at Wilcox-Holdrege Thursday.

The Warriors trailed 10-7 after a quarter, but the offense came to life in the second with a 20-point explosion, leaping the Warriors into a 27-17 lead at the half.

Arapahoe didn’t stop there as they scored 20 more in the third to take a 20-point lead to the fourth, up 47-27. From there, the Warriors rolled to the finish in a 30-point win.

Cooper Wendland scored 18 and grabbed seven rebounds to lead the Warriors while Tyler Miller scored 12 and grabbed five boards. Andre Wasenius abs Campbell Schutz each scored nine and Wasenius grabbed 11 rebounds and added six steals and three assists. Grant Taylor scored seven and had five boards while dishing three assists and swiping three steals.
